Why play it

Join Tucho in his quest to rescue his friends and liberate the colorfully grotesque lands of Teratopia! Traverse 13 unique zones packed with enemies bent on overtaking your homeland. But fear not! The power of friendship arms you with fellow Teratopians and a diverse set of skills to face a family of red invaders. Immerse yourself in an adventure full of action, and strategize on-the-go to better overcome your foes! Play as either Tucho the brawler, Benito the shooter, or Horacio the trickster, each with their own strengths and skills.

Story and worldbuilding

In the world of Teratopia, three different races have coexisted in harmony for centuries, until a race of red aliens invaded the lands and abducted their inhabitants, for purposes unknown. Only Tucho, the cutest and most easy-going of the bunch, managed to escape. It's up to him to free his friends and join forces with them to overcome the red invasion.

Teratopia struggles with basic gameplay design from combat to platforming. For an action-adventure platformer, that’s always a bad sign.

Teratopia doesn't know which genre it wants to fit in, doesn't know who it's for and seems not to be able to decide on a tone to maintain. Even putting aside the appaling lack of ambition, it is deeply flawed in the most basic of concepts, resulting in an experience that's equal parts boring and frustrating.

Teratopia‘s biggest flaw is that it doesn’t know what kind of game it wanted to be. It has beyond basic controls, but it’s too hard for children to play. It looks like an adorable kid’s game and has lots of silly humor, but then there are random moments of adult level jokes and references. I’m honestly not sure who this game is meant for. Let’s just save us all some trouble and say it’s not enjoyable for anyone.

t’s so unfortunate that so much of Teratopia between the boss fights feels like monotonous, repetitive filler. The platforming is basic, the combat often feels like just mashing X and the frame rate can occasionally tank which makes it uncomfortable to play. There was certainly potential hidden in this game but it falls short of being realised.

Teratopia offers us a combination between brawler and a quite curious real-time strategy game. Its aesthetics and its tone loaded with humor will attract the youngest, but the older ones will also know how to see its benefits. It has performance problems that must be solved, but overall we can not say that it is bad game.
